THE TUNNEL - Short Horror Film
Vložit
- čas přidán 27. 10. 2022
- A man walks through a seemingly mundane tunnel.
-------- Credits --------
Directed by Alex Spear & Andrew Clabaugh
Written by Andrew Clabaugh
Produced by Alex Spear, Andrew Clabaugh, & Jordan Frechtman
Cinematography by Colin Duffy
Edited by Erin St. Pierre
Music & Sound by Alexandre Côté
Starring Jordan Frechtman & Andrew Clabaugh
Special Thanks: Cody Buchanan, Eddie Chevez, Conor McAdam, Cameron Ross, Brian Sutherin, Los Angeles Camera Rentals
